Market Context
Infrastructure equities have attracted renewed attention in recent months as investors weigh the sector's defensive characteristics against potential headwinds from monetary policy expectations. Trading volume for Brookfield Infrastructure Corporation has reflected this increased interest, with activity remaining elevated compared to historical averages as market participants assess positioning opportunities within the infrastructure subsector.
The broader utilities and infrastructure complex has shown mixed performance characteristics recently, with rate-sensitive segments facing pressure while assets with stronger growth profiles have demonstrated relative resilience. BIPC's diversified approach across multiple infrastructure verticals provides exposure to various demand drivers, including digital infrastructure expansion, transportation volume trends, and utility modernization initiatives.
Sector rotation dynamics have played a role in shaping trading patterns for infrastructure companies broadly. When risk-off sentiment dominates market sentiment, the stable cash flow profiles of infrastructure assets tend to support investor interest. Conversely, periods of risk-on trading may see capital flow toward higher-growth alternatives, potentially creating headwinds for defensive sectors.
Brookfield Infrastructure Corporation benefits from its relationship with Brookfield Asset Management, one of the world's leading alternative asset managers, which provides institutional-quality management expertise and access to a global deal pipeline. This connection has historically facilitated growth through acquisitions and asset optimization, though integration execution and capital allocation decisions remain ongoing considerations for long-term shareholders.

Technical Analysis
From a technical perspective, BIPC shares are trading in the middle portion of the identified trading range, with support established near $37.18 and resistance clustering around $41.10. The current price action suggests consolidation rather than directional momentum, as the stock oscillates between these key levels without generating clear trend signals.
The relative strength index suggests the shares are not currently in overbought or oversold territory, indicating room for movement in either direction without immediate technical warning signs. Moving average analysis shows the stock trading near key intermediate-term averages, which could serve as reference points for trend assessment. When price action clusters near these averages, it often reflects periods of uncertainty where directional conviction remains limited among market participants.
Volume patterns during recent sessions have shown moderate activity, neither confirming strong selling pressure nor suggesting accumulation by informed buyers. This balanced volume profile is consistent with the consolidation interpretation, where supply and demand forces remain relatively in equilibrium.
Support at $37.18 represents a level where buying interest has historically emerged during prior pullbacks. If the stock approaches this zone, technical analysts might anticipate potential stabilization attempts, though the strength of any bounce would depend on broader market conditions at that time. The resistance level at $41.10 has demonstrated its significance through prior rejection of higher prices, suggesting supply concentration in that area.
Traders monitoring BIPC may want to observe how the stock behaves as it approaches either end of the current range. A sustained move below support could signal deeper technical damage, while a successful breach of resistance might indicate improving momentum and increased bullish interest.

Outlook
For Brookfield Infrastructure Corporation, several factors could influence the stock's trajectory in the near term. The essential nature of the company's asset base provides some insulation from economic cyclicality, as infrastructure services typically maintain demand regardless of broader economic conditions. This defensive characteristic may attract interest during periods of market volatility.
The company's capital allocation strategy, including dividend policy and reinvestment priorities, represents an ongoing consideration for income-oriented investors. Infrastructure companies often balance shareholder returns with growth investments, and the specifics of this balance can influence long-term total return potential.
From a technical standpoint, the $37.18 to $41.10 range provides a framework for assessing potential scenarios. Market participants may want to monitor for confirmed breaks above or below these levels, which could signal the beginning of a more directional move. Until such breaks occur, the consolidation pattern suggests a neutral stance where range-bound trading could persist.
Broader interest rate expectations continue to influence sentiment toward utilities and infrastructure equities, as the sector's capital-intensive nature makes it sensitive to financing costs. Any shifts in monetary policy expectations could create opportunities or headwinds for BIPC and its infrastructure peers.
Investors considering Brookfield Infrastructure Corporation should weigh the company's diversified asset portfolio, its connection to Brookfield Asset Management, and current technical positioning against their overall portfolio strategy and risk tolerance.
